Meaning of "Heart Of Stone" by Cher


"Heart of Stone" delves into the complexities and fragility of love, highlighting the emotional toll that relationships can take on individuals. The lyrics vividly paint a picture of heartbreak, loss, and a longing for emotional armor to shield oneself from the pain of love. Cher's contemplation on the fleeting nature of love and the inevitable hurt that comes along with it strikes a chord with listeners who have experienced heartbreak or disappointment in relationships. The references to being hurt together but also feeling the pain alone underscore the isolating nature of emotional distress, as well as the internal conflict that arises from wanting to be strong while yearning for protection. By longing for a heart of stone, the singer expresses a desire to be impervious to the emotional turmoil that often accompanies love. Ultimately, "Heart of Stone" reflects on the paradoxical nature of love - its ability to bring both joy and sorrow, vulnerability and strength.
